Waterfront Cafe Receives Good Neighbor Recognition Award from NEWRA Clean Streets
Shown (l to r) Tony Iantosca, Clean Streets Committee member Janet Gilardi and owner Rocco Zagarella. (Photo by Phil Orlandella) Waterfront Cafe Bar & Grill, 450 Commercial St., is the winner of the June 2011 Good Neighbor Recognition Award from the Clean Streets Committee, part of the North End / Waterfront Residents’ Association (NEWRA).
